POINTSCORE RESULTS GUIDE
(Obtaining Catalogue Numbers)
When calculating catalogue numbers, always have the following in mind ...
- If you win a Best or Runner-Up in Show, you need to submit the catalogue numbers for the Show.
- If you win Best or Runner-Up in Group, you need to submit the catalogue numbers for the Group.
- If you win Best or Runner-Up of Breed, you need to submit the catalogue numbers for the Breed.
- In all cases, DO NOT DEDUCT the absentees or baby puppies. The points calculation is based on the number of entries listed as per the catalogue.
- Submit the number of entries as per the catalogue, NOT the number of points that you should be awarded. The system will calculate the correct number of points you should be awarded for your win based on the number of entries as per the catalogue.
The following guide will give you examples on how to obtain catalogue numbers. Please ensure that you check how the catalogue for your show is formatted. Any results received where the catalogue (or entry) numbers are incorrect, may mean your result will be disqualified from that show.
It is up to you to check how the catalogue for your particular show is formatted!
(Never assume the catalogue is in a certain format)

Multiple Days Show in One Catalogue Example

When a catalogue is similar to the above and there is multiple days listed in the same catalogue, you must physically count the entries for the particular day of your win and submit the number of entries. (We will not accept the first and last catalogue number in this instance as it would give the incorrect number of entries).
In the example above, if you receive Best of Breed for the Welsh Corgi (Pembroke) on the Friday, the total number of entries that you would submit would be 4 (dogs 319, 321 and 323 were not entered at the Friday show).
If you received Runner-Up Best of Breed on the Saturday, you would submit 6 as the total number of entries.
